Pretty Baby actor Brooke Shields has spoken out about how her mom agreed for her to pose for Playboy when she was just 10 years old.

Most younger people now will likely know Shields for her appearances in titles like Friends or That 70s Show, rom-com Chalet Girl or Netflix's recent movie, Mother of the Bride.

However, the 59-year-old has been in the entertainment industry for decades, and earned her first acting credits in the 1970s, before she was even a teenager.

Advert

She got work with the help of her mom at the time, but it wasn't just acting in movies and TV shows that Shields found herself doing as a child.

When she was 10 years old, Shield's mom, Teri, agreed that she could pose completely nude for a photoshoot for the Playboy publication, Sugar and Spice.

She had her makeup done and appeared full-frontal, all at an age long before she would be considered an adult.

In 2014, two years after the death of her mother, Shields looked back at her relationship with her mom in a book titled In There Was a Little Girl: The Real Story of My Mother and Me.

Shields opened up about her mom, but in an interview with The Times last year she admitted there were still things she held back.

She breezed over the Playboy incident in the book, telling The Times: “It was too much for me to cop to that, really. Writing about it just broke me. It was her that I was protecting.”

Though Shields has agreed it was her mom's job to 'protect' her as a child, she said she wasn't angry with her mom for the decisions she'd made in the past.

“Everyone wanted me to be angry with her, but anger was just too sad for me to take when I looked at how insecure she was,” she explained.

Last year, Shields shared more details about her life in a documentary titled Brooke Shields: Pretty Baby.

In looking back at her life, she said: “That made me look at what kind of person I am and to give myself a little credit.

"I had to contend with so much at such an early age, and there was resilience, but also I put on blinders as a defence mechanism. But now I can look at that little girl and think, ‘She did it, she pulled through.’ ”
